The global metal closures market has demonstrated a robust performance, underpinned by its critical role in packaging solutions across various industries. Valued at approximately USD 25.17 billion in 2023, the market is projected to reach USD 41.14 billion by 2032,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.69% . This growth trajectory reflects the increasing demand for secure, sustainable, and efficient packaging solutions.


Market Dynamics: Drivers of Growth

1. Sustainability and Environmental Considerations

Sustainability has become a pivotal factor influencing the packaging industry. Metal closures, particularly those made from aluminum and steel, are highly recyclable and align with the growing consumer preference for eco-friendly products. The push towards reducing plastic usage has further propelled the adoption of metal closures, as they offer a more sustainable alternative .

2. Technological Advancements

Innovations in closure technologies have enhanced the functionality and appeal of metal closures. Features such as tamper-evident seals, child-resistant mechanisms, and smart closures with integrated tracking systems have expanded their application beyond traditional uses. These advancements cater to the evolving needs of industries like pharmaceuticals, beverages, and personal care, where product integrity and consumer safety are paramount .

3. Expanding End-Use Applications

The food and beverage sector remains the largest consumer of metal closures, driven by the increasing demand for packaged drinks and ready-to-eat meals. Additionally, the pharmaceutical industry's emphasis on secure and sterile packaging solutions has bolstered the demand for metal closures. The cosmetics and personal care sectors are also witnessing a rise in the use of metal closures, attributed to their premium appeal and protective qualities .


Regional Performance Insights

Asia-Pacific

Asia-Pacific stands as the largest and fastest-growing market for metal closures, accounting for a significant share of global consumption. Countries like China and India are experiencing rapid industrialization, urbanization, and a burgeoning middle class, all contributing to the increased demand for packaged goods. The region's market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 7.5% during the forecast period, driven by the food and beverage industry's expansion and rising disposable incomes .

North America

North America holds a substantial share of the metal closures market, driven by established industries and stringent regulatory standards. The United States, in particular, exhibits high per capita consumption of beverages, which bolsters the demand for metal closures. The region's focus on sustainable packaging solutions and advancements in closure technologies further support market growth .

Europe

Europe's market is characterized by a strong emphasis on sustainability and recycling. The region's commitment to reducing carbon footprints and enhancing recycling rates has led to increased adoption of metal closures. Countries with stringent environmental regulations have accelerated the shift towards recyclable packaging materials, positioning metal closures as a preferred choice in the region .


Challenges Impacting Market Performance

1. Raw Material Price Fluctuations

The cost of raw materials, particularly aluminum and steel, significantly influences the production costs of metal closures. Volatility in global metal prices can lead to increased manufacturing expenses, affecting profitability and pricing strategies. For instance, the price of aluminum has experienced fluctuations due to factors like supply chain disruptions and geopolitical tensions .

2. Competition from Alternative Materials

Plastic closures continue to pose competition to metal closures, primarily due to their lower cost and lightweight properties. While metal closures offer superior sealing and recyclability, the affordability and versatility of plastic alternatives make them attractive to cost-sensitive industries, potentially limiting the market share of metal closures .

3. Regulatory Compliance

Manufacturers of metal closures must navigate a complex landscape of safety, environmental, and quality regulations. Compliance with these standards can be resource-intensive, requiring continuous monitoring and adaptation to changing policies. Non-compliance can lead to product recalls, legal liabilities, and reputational damage .
